Randy Rogers Band to Headline El Paso’s America 250 Celebration on July 4

The Randy Rogers Band will headline El Paso’s America 250 celebration on Saturday, July 4, bringing live country music and a full evening of festivities to downtown’s San Jacinto Plaza.

The free event, scheduled from 5 to 10 p.m., is part of the nationwide commemoration marking the 250th anniversary of the United States. Organizers say attendees can expect live entertainment, local food vendors, family-friendly activities and kid zones throughout the evening.

The Randy Rogers Band, a longtime Texas country favorite known for hits including “In My Arms Instead” and “Kiss Me in the Dark,” will headline the celebration with what organizers describe as a high-energy performance.

Visit El Paso said the event will celebrate both the nation’s history and the spirit of the Borderland community while bringing residents and visitors together for an evening of music and entertainment.

The celebration will take place at San Jacinto Plaza in downtown El Paso and is open to the public at no cost.
